  1. 22 hours ago · EKG depiction of left ventricular hypertrophy. Left ventricular hypertrophy is a leading cause of sudden cardiac deaths in the adult population. This is most commonly the result of longstanding high blood pressure, or hypertension, which has led to maladaptive overgrowth of muscular tissue of the left ventricle, the heart's main pumping chamber.

  3. Jul 17, 2024 · The echocardiographic criteria for a severe aortic valve stenosis are usually a mean atrioventricular gradient of ≥40mmHg with a peak doppler velocity across the valve of ≥4.0m/s.     22 hours ago · 2.36 billion / 33% (2015) [2] Anemia or anaemia ( British English) is a blood disorder in which the blood has a reduced ability to carry oxygen. This can be due to a lower than normal number of red blood cells, a reduction in the amount of hemoglobin available for oxygen transport, or abnormalities in hemoglobin that impair its function.
